跨境专用OpenClaw(龙虾)how to write scripts
2026-03-19 1引言
跨境专用OpenClaw(龙虾)how to write scripts 是指面向跨境电商运营人员,使用开源自动化框架 OpenClaw(社区俗称“龙虾”)编写脚本,实现平台数据抓取、页面交互、批量操作等任务的技术实践。OpenClaw 并非商业SaaS产品,而是基于 Playwright/Puppeteer 的轻量级脚本开发框架,常用于绕过平台反爬限制或补足官方API能力缺口。

要点速读(TL;DR)
- OpenClaw(龙虾)是开源脚本框架,非平台官方工具,无SDK/认证接入流程;
- “how to write scripts”核心是用 TypeScript/JavaScript 编写可复用、可维护的浏览器自动化逻辑;
- 适用场景:竞品价格监控、Listing信息采集、多账号基础操作(如变体合并模拟)、非敏感类目批量上架辅助;
- 不支持直接对接支付/订单/库存等核心业务API,不可替代ERP或合规API方案;
- 需自行部署运行环境,遵守目标平台《Robots.txt》及《Terms of Service》,高风险操作易触发风控。
它能解决哪些问题
- 场景化痛点→对应价值:平台官方API未开放某类数据(如Review时间戳、Seller Central前端隐藏字段)→ 用OpenClaw模拟真实用户行为提取结构化HTML/JSON;
- 场景化痛点→对应价值:ERP或选品工具无法覆盖小众站点(如Amazon UAE、Shopee泰国)→ 自行编写适配脚本,低成本快速验证可行性;
- 场景化痛点→对应价值:人工执行重复性前端操作(如每日更新50个SKU的图片ALT文本)→ 脚本自动定位元素、填充表单、提交保存,节省80%+人力。
怎么用/怎么开通/怎么选择
OpenClaw(龙虾)无“开通”概念,属开发者自建工具链。常见做法如下(以Amazon卖家为例):
- 确认合规边界:查阅目标平台《Acceptable Use Policy》中关于自动化访问条款(如Amazon明确禁止“automated access to Seller Central without prior written consent”);
- 搭建本地环境:安装Node.js ≥18.x + Git,执行
git clone https://github.com/openclaw/openclaw(以GitHub主仓库为准); - 配置浏览器实例:选用Playwright Chromium并启用--disable-blink-features=AutomationControlled等反检测参数;
- 编写首个脚本:参考
examples/amazon-listing-scraper.ts模板,使用page.locator()精准定位元素,避免XPath硬编码; - 添加登录态管理:通过
storageState复用已登录Cookie,规避MFA拦截(需手动首次登录并保存状态); - 部署与调度:使用PM2或GitHub Actions定时运行,日志需记录
response.status()与page.url()用于失败归因。
费用/成本通常受哪些因素影响
- 开发者人力成本(TypeScript熟练度直接影响脚本稳定性);
- 服务器资源开销(并发数、浏览器实例内存占用、长期运行稳定性);
- 代理IP服务支出(高频请求必需,否则易被封IP或触发验证码);
- 目标平台风控强度(如Walmart Seller Center比Newegg更严格,脚本重试逻辑复杂度上升);
- 维护成本(平台前端改版后,CSS选择器失效需及时更新脚本)。
为了拿到准确成本,你通常需要准备:目标平台URL列表、所需字段清单、日均请求数、期望成功率SLA(如≥95%)、是否需分布式部署。
常见坑与避坑清单
- ❌ 直接复用网上公开脚本:含硬编码账号密码、过期Selector、无错误重试机制,极易导致批量封号;
- ❌ 忽略User-Agent与时区指纹:同一IP下所有请求使用相同UA+时区+语言,暴露自动化特征;
- ❌ 未设置请求间隔与随机延迟:固定1s请求节奏被识别为机器人,建议3–8s随机区间+Jitter扰动;
- ❌ 将OpenClaw用于支付/订单修改等敏感操作:违反平台ToS,且无事务一致性保障,可能引发资金或库存异常。
FAQ
{关键词} 靠谱吗/正规吗/是否合规?
OpenClaw(龙虾)本身是MIT协议开源项目,代码透明、无后门;但使用方式决定合规性。若用于绕过平台反爬、高频刷单、伪造评价等,即属违规。合规前提是:仅用于自身店铺数据查看、非侵入式信息采集、遵守robots.txt与平台AUP条款,并控制请求频次与指纹特征。
{关键词} 适合哪些卖家/平台/类目?
适合具备前端开发能力或有技术协作资源的中大型跨境团队;平台覆盖Amazon、eBay、Walmart、Shopee等支持标准HTML渲染的站点;类目上,标品(如手机壳、数据线)因页面结构稳定更易脚本化,而定制化/高动态类目(如服装尺码表JS异步加载)维护成本显著升高。
{关键词} 常见失败原因是什么?如何排查?
最常见失败原因:① 平台前端改版导致locator失效;② 代理IP池质量差,返回验证码页但脚本未识别;③ Cookie过期未自动刷新登录态。排查方法:开启headless: false模式录屏观察实际渲染流程;捕获page.on('response')检查HTTP状态码;用page.screenshot({ fullPage: true })留存失败现场。
结尾
OpenClaw(龙虾)how to write scripts 是技术杠杆,不是合规捷径——写得越快,越要懂规则。

